摘要
研究多技能人力资源在项目活动上的指派与调度问题.首先,从问题特点出发,把原始问题分解为指派问题子模型和调度问题子模型.然后,对项目活动间的重叠关系进行识别,将其转化为对指派问题的有效约束,构建数学规划与约束规划相结合的混合算法对问题求解,并采用CPLEX编程实现.研究表明,算法可有效缩减指派问题的可行域,快速地找到问题的近优解,从而提高多技能人力资源的使用效率,是求解项目多技能人力资源指派与调度问题的一个有效方法.
A complicated project scheduling problem with multi-skilled human resources allocated in different activities was studied in this paper. First of all, according to the characteristics of the problem, the original problem was decomposed into two sub modules: assignment module and scheduling module. After that, we put forward a method to identify the overlap relationship between activities, and turned the overlap relationship into the constraint conditions of assignment sub module. Thus, the feasible region of assignment problem can be reduced effectively. Finally, we built an IMP/CP hybrid algorithm and programed it using CPLEX to solve the problem. Example experiment proved that, using this method can effectively reduce the feasible region assignment problem, and find the near optimal solution of the problem quickly, thus to improve the efficiency of the human resources in projects. It is an effective method to solve the problem of multi-skilled human resources assignment and project scheduling.
作者
李明
李前进
LIMing LI Qian-jin(School of Economics and Management, Shijiazhuang Tiedao University, Shijiazhuang 050043, China School of Economics and Management, Beihang University, Beijing 100191, China)
出处
《数学的实践与认识》
北大核心
2017年第19期20-28,共9页
Mathematics in Practice and Theory
基金
国家自然科学基金(71271019)
河北省社会科学基金(HB14GL023)
河北省高等学校科学技术研究项目(QN2014035)
河北省重点学科(管理科学与工程)
河北省教育厅人文社科重点研究基地资助
关键词
多技能
人力资源
指派
项目调度
multi-skilled
human resource
allocation
project scheduling